Bulldogs Split with HSE

The Bulldogs split an HCC series with HSE this past weekend winning the opening game 7-2 but dropping the Saturday afternoon game by the score of 8-4.  In the Friday night game, the Bulldogs were led by the strong pitching performance of junior LHP Triston Polley (2-1).  Polley threw the first complete game of the season for any Bulldog pitcher and struck out 6 HSE batters while only allowing 2 runs.  Offensively, the Bulldogs took the lead early with a Tyler Houston home run in the bottom of the 1st.  The Dogs tacked on a few more runs in the 3rd, 4th, and 5th to push the lead to 7-1 going into the 7th.  The Royals snuck one run across in the seventh, but Polley was able to shut the door on the rally.  The Dogs were led by Houston (2-2); Tyler Westrich (2-3) and Anthony Travelsted (1-3).
 
On Saturday, the Dogs were unable to sweep the series, but played well despite one inning.  Junior RHP Michael Klayer got the nod for the Bulldogs and provided 3 2/3 innings work before a few errors and walks in the 4thallowed the Royals a big 4-run inning.  Junior LHP Matt Rollyson and senior RHP David LeClerc came in to relieve Klayer.  Offensively, the Bulldogs really couldn't get much going all game.  The Dogs had runners on all day, but couldn't string together enough consecutive hits to put anything together.  The Dogs were again led by senior OF Tyler Houton and senior OF Tyler Westrich while junior C Brooks Bireley was on base all three times and junior PH Owen Gilbert was able to drive a run home on an infield hit. 
 
The Bulldogs move to 7-4 on the season and 2-4 in the HCC.
